Transaction e4ba59aa3fa74d88d44a38a96c3559696c5a3058493d84c46419d31a76b10b72
1 Input
2 Outputs
- e4ba59aa3fa74d88d44a38a96c3559696c5a3058493d84c46419d31a76b10b72:0
- e4ba59aa3fa74d88d44a38a96c3559696c5a3058493d84c46419d31a76b10b72:1
value 873532
address 163mDDy9iAgmvopnt5eJqhFqLa7WgXbYD2
value 596657
address 3DdXFwekquDoUj2aBPi41VYdXxYhozPwXi